Random Tech Cat CL9

If you plan on upgrading your catalytic converter with the Random Tech Cat and keeping the stock exhaust, you should know that there are no gaskets that come with it and no place on the Random Cat itself to put a metal o-ring gasket like the one in the header.

the reason why i bring this up is it could cause gas exhaust to leak at the connection joint of the cat and stock exhaust. I am curently trying to figure out if there is some type of aluminum or steel gasket that I could cut out and make to solve this porblem but then again, most people upgrade there exhaust as well when they do any exhaust, header or cat mods. This is just a kind heads up. I am still waiting on my T1R exhaust to get to me so I am hoping there is some type of gasket for that exhaust or else i am going to have to fabricate one.
